integer function ieeeck (integerISPEC, realZERO, realONE)

IEEECK
Purpose:
 IEEECK is called from the ILAENV to verify that Infinity and
 possibly NaN arithmetic is safe (i.e. will not trap).
Parameters:
ISPEC
          ISPEC is INTEGER
          Specifies whether to test just for inifinity arithmetic
          or whether to test for infinity and NaN arithmetic.
          = 0: Verify infinity arithmetic only.
          = 1: Verify infinity and NaN arithmetic.
ZERO
          ZERO is REAL
          Must contain the value 0.0
          This is passed to prevent the compiler from optimizing
          away this code.
ONE
          ONE is REAL
          Must contain the value 1.0
          This is passed to prevent the compiler from optimizing
          away this code.
RETURN VALUE: INTEGER = 0: Arithmetic failed to produce the correct answers = 1: Arithmetic produced the correct answers
